The Turks of Central Asia: In History and at the Present Day
Author: Czaplicka, M.A.
Publisher: Curzon Press, London
Description: An ethnological enquiry into the Pan-Turanian problem, and bibliographical material relating to the early turks and the present Turks of Central Asia
Source: Archaeological Survey of India, New Delhi
Type: Rare Book
Received From: Archaeological Survey of India
